Tatum Jumps!

Tatum Jumps! I have been starting to take Tatum out in the back yard and I’m introducing her to jumps. Today before dinner she was so enthusiastic! I was thrilled. I held her back and said ‘rreeaaaddy….’, and over the jump she went! I was thrilled! We did it a few more times and she just had a great time.

Tatum Jumping Using a cottage cheese lid, I use it as a target for her to head toward after she jumps, loaded with a treat. So she’ll focus forward and keep her head down. Gotta get all the parts right for starting her to jump. I can’t wait until I can get her going on more than one jump, and take her out to where I practice!
